Histochemical and histoenzymatic changes in mouse liver in subacute benzene intoxication. 1978

M Kamiński, and J J Jonek, and J Konecki, and O Kamińska, and B Gruszeczka, and B Koehler

The investigations were performed on mice. They were divided into a control group and 4 experimental groups. The experimental animals were administered intraperitoneally benzene 6 X every 24 h. The animals were decapitated 30 min. 4, 12 and 24 h after the last benzene administration. During the experiment, dyeing for neutral lipids and glycogen was carried out, and the activity of NADH2-r.t., SDH, G-6-Pase, ATP-ase and ACP was estimated. A decrease of glycogen content in liver cells, deviations in the amount of neutral lipids, reversible decrease of mitochondrial enzymes activity, and intensification of the processes of intracellular catabolism were found.

D001554 Benzene Toxic, volatile, flammable liquid hydrocarbon byproduct of coal distillation. It is used as an industrial solvent in paints, varnishes, lacquer thinners, gasoline, etc. Benzene causes central nervous system damage acutely and bone marrow damage chronically and is carcinogenic. It was formerly used as parasiticide. Benzol,Benzole,Cyclohexatriene

D013385 Succinate Dehydrogenase A flavoprotein containing oxidoreductase that catalyzes the dehydrogenation of SUCCINATE to fumarate. In most eukaryotic organisms this enzyme is a component of mitochondrial electron transport complex II.
